DECISION & ORDER ON APPLICATION

Application by Robert Katulak, as executor of the estate of John Katulak, to substitute Robert Katulak, as executor of the estate of John Katulak, for the decedent John Katulak on appeals from three orders of the Supreme Court, Orange County, all dated January 7, 2008.

Upon the papers filed in support of the application and upon the stipulation of the parties, it is

ORDERED that the application is granted and Robert Katulak, as executor of the estate of John Katulak, is substituted for the decedent John Katulak, and the caption is amended accordingly.
